Tag: Freedom of the City of London
Olu of Warri’s wife Olori Ivie Atuwatse awarded Freedom of the...
Queen Consort of Warri Olori Ivie Atuwatse III has been awarded Freedom of the City of London.
The award is one of the United Kingdom's...